A Social Worker plays a critical role in the social service industry by providing assistance and support to people facing various challenges in their lives, including mental health issues, poverty, addiction, and abuse. Their responsibilities often include conducting assessments, developing and implementing intervention strategies, providing counseling, and connecting clients with necessary resources and services. They work in various settings such as schools, hospitals, government agencies, and non-profit organizations, where they advocate for social justice and changes in policies.
In terms of skills, a good Social Worker should have excellent communication, emotional intelligence, problem-solving skills, and the ability to work with diverse populations. They should also possess a strong sense of empathy and patience, as well as the ability to handle stress effectively. Regarding certifications, most positions require at least a Bachelor's degree in Social Work (BSW), with many requiring a Master's degree in Social Work (MSW). Additional certifications such as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W) or Certified Social Worker in Health (C-SWH) may also be required, depending on the role and state regulations. Prior to becoming a Social Worker, individuals may have roles such as Social Work Assistant, Case Manager, or Mental Health Counselor.
